Does anyone know how to add trim around a an arch top window that is in a 5'-0" radius curved wall?

Is the trim decorative, or just a flat profile?
the trim is very decorative.
You need to make it as a plan extrusion, then a blend void in elevation. So in plan, click extrusion, draw a solid shape the thickness of your trim and make it from your spring point to the top of the trim, then in elevation, use a void to cut the bottom and top off. This gets you a curved arch shape. For the detail you will have to create that as either linework or a sep family that you nest in and copy around as needed.

Here is a quick example showing the process. I do these in place in reality I just cant post a whole model, so this family shows the process. Since you can't curve the wall in a family, you need to make it in place or provide radius parameters in the trim family.
